Class DeclarativeAiServiceCreateInfo
java.lang.Object
io.quarkiverse.langchain4j.runtime.aiservice.DeclarativeAiServiceCreateInfo
-
Constructor Summary
ConstructorsConstructorDescriptionDeclarativeAiServiceCreateInfo(String serviceClassName, String languageModelSupplierClassName, List<String> toolsClassNames, String chatMemoryProviderSupplierClassName, String retrieverClassName, String retrievalAugmentorSupplierClassName, String auditServiceClassSupplierName, String moderationModelSupplierClassName, String chatModelName, boolean needsStreamingChatModel) -
Method Summary
Modifier and TypeMethodDescriptionboolean
-
Constructor Details
-
DeclarativeAiServiceCreateInfo
public DeclarativeAiServiceCreateInfo(String serviceClassName, String languageModelSupplierClassName, List<String> toolsClassNames, String chatMemoryProviderSupplierClassName, String retrieverClassName, String retrievalAugmentorSupplierClassName, String auditServiceClassSupplierName, String moderationModelSupplierClassName, String chatModelName, boolean needsStreamingChatModel)
-
-
Method Details
-
getServiceClassName
-
getLanguageModelSupplierClassName
-
getToolsClassNames
-
getChatMemoryProviderSupplierClassName
-
getRetrieverClassName
-
getRetrievalAugmentorSupplierClassName
-
getAuditServiceClassSupplierName
-
getModerationModelSupplierClassName
-
getChatModelName
-
getNeedsStreamingChatModel
public boolean getNeedsStreamingChatModel()
-